My 22’ 2500 CC/LB rides a lot worse than the 18’ CC/SB I had. It just has a jitteriness to it that is bad enough you can’t carry on a conversation. I don’t know if it has to do with the off road package or it’s something to do with the cab mounts but it’s rough.
 
Did you ever figure out if this is right? Mine look weird to me as well. And I get a clunk in the front end every now and then. I've read up a little bit on loose cab mounts but haven't seen anything about a fix.
 
I’ve looked at several and they all have space in them. I put an extra piece of rubber under the transmission/transfer case mount and it stopped some of the shaking I’m experiencing with my truck. It’s kinda like the motor and transmission are balanced and just floating in the frame. I picked the transfer case up about 2 inches by hand. That doesn’t seem right to me.
